Photovoltaic cells deliver a voltage among their front and backsides. Either side should be electrically contacted. Not less than for your entrance facet (and for bifacial cells, the bottom also), this have to be done in such a way that the light enter is minimized as little as is possible. The typical approach for regular silicon cells is to use a grid of great “finger” wires connected to more substantial “bus bars” by monitor printing a silver paste on to the front surface area.

Semiconductors are materials that show conductive properties concerning that of a conductor (e.g. copper) Which of an insulator (e.g. glass). Semiconductors official source are used in many different electronic factors like diodes, transistors and solar cells. In this sort of factors/products the benefit of doping the semiconductors are employed, offering the semiconductors one of a kind Qualities to aid or block the transportation of electrons and holes below various problems.
